#593832 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#593832 is composed of 34.9% red, 22% green and 19.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.1% magenta, 43.8%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 9.2 degrees, a saturation of 28.1% and a lightness of 27.3%. #593832 color hex could be obtained by blending #b27064 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

● #593832 color description : Very dark desaturated red.
#593832 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#593832 has RGB values of R:89, G:56, B:50 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.44,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 5847090.

Shades and Tints of #593832
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f9f4f4 is the lightest one.
